Hinduism is among many religions that afford adaptability and the freedom of choice and religious expression. Furthermore, Hinduism has a history of adopting the ideas of other faiths. Cards are and have been used to express sympathy, and flowers are commonly used in last rites.
Yes, it is a nice gesture to send thank-you notes to guests who signed the guest book at a funeral. Thank-you notes should definitely be sent to those who sent cards, memorial donations, or flowers.
